I was wondering whether anyone else encountered this issue ... I've installed the Addictive Drums 2 demo version and try to use it in Cubase 7.5 on Mac. The standalone works fine but the plugin seems to have trouble in Cubase as the window doesn't disappear properly. The window GUI goes black and the window cannot be closed at all (see screenshot). It will only disappear after I switched to another app that covers the screen. It's the first plugin I'm having trouble with like this in Cubase.
Any known solution to this problem?

Aharr! I found the problem! This issue only happens when Cubase runs in 32bit mode on Mac, which it strangely did on my system after I installed it. I had to set it to explicitly run as 64bit and reboot and the problem is gone since then.
